I will be moving out to California summer of 2013 and will be taking about three weeks to transit the country. As of right now, I will be starting my overland journey in Colorado, and continuing through Montana, Wyoming, Idaho, Utah, and Arizona before reaching my final destination in San Diego. This will be my first overlanding trip so I decided to make it over 2,000 miles lol. My father as my sidekick, we will take on the Rockies and adjacent mountain ranges together. Personally, I think it's a little too ambitious and I won't make it all the way to Arizona, but we'll see.

I will need a tool for the job and so my 07 Tacoma will be revamped for the extended overlanding expedition. I figured since the truck was going in a different direction it deserved a new build. Looking to have the truck 90% finished by the end of January.

Current Mods:

Exterior Modifications:
-SP Slotted Rotors
-Hawk LTS Brake Pads
-FX-R AsianAnts Retrofit w/ Custom Halos
-3000K HID Fog Lights
-De-badged
-Custom Sockmonkey Tailgate Decal
-Black Calipers
-Blacked-Out LED 09' Style Tail Lights
-Custom Thule Bed Rack
-Bed Bar w/ Back-up Lights
-40” OKLEDLIGHTBARS LED Lightbar - Roof Mounted - http://www.tacomaworld.com/forum/2n...f-mounted-40-led-lightbar-build-coil-fab.html

Wheels/Tires:
-17X8 Konig Countersteer Type X
-285/70/17 Goodyear Wrangler MT/R with Kevlar

Suspension Modifications:
-Front: - 23.5" from hub to fender
-2.0 Radflo Coilovers (650# coils)
-Rear: - 25.5" from hub to fender
-OME Dakar Leaf Pack
-Icon VS Series 2.0 Monotube

Armor Modifications:
-BruteForce Hybrid Front Bumper w/ Superwinch Tigershark 9500

Interior Modifications:
-Scanguage II
-Alpine IVA-W505 DVD Receiver w/ NAV
-Tacoma All-Weather Floormats
-Cobra CB Radio
-Custom Shift Knob (Courtesy of USAF)
-Blue LED Dome Light
-OTRATTW – Contura V Rocker Switches

Performance Modifications:
-TRD Cold Air Intake w/ Custom Intake Cover
-TRD Cat-back Exhaust
-Doug Thorley Long Tube Headers
-URD Mass Air Flow Sensor Calibrator
